Description:
The 50th anniversary edition.(3cd+dvd)
The original 1968 album remixed to stereo and 4.1 surround by Steven Wilson .
Includes unreleased recordings and alternative versions. - 50TH ANNIVERSARY EDITION
Recorded at Sound Techniques Studio, Chelsea, London. Thursday 13th June to Friday 23rd August (1968).
Remixed to stereo by Steven Wilson.
Made in E.U.
Tracks 13 to 16 were previously unreleased.
"This Was (50th Anniversary Edition)" is a special reissue of Jethro Tull's groundbreaking debut album, originally released in 1968. This deluxe CD edition celebrates half a century since the band's first foray into the music world, featuring remastered tracks and bonus material that offer both longtime fans and new listeners an immersive experience. The album showcases Jethro Tull?s early blues-rock roots with hints of jazz and folk influences, capturing their innovative spirit before they evolved into progressive rock legends. Highlights include classics like "My Sunday Feeling" and "A Song for Jeffrey." Jethro Tull, led by charismatic frontman Ian Anderson, are renowned for their eclectic style and have sold over 60 million albums worldwide. Their unique blend of genres has earned them critical acclaim and a dedicated global following.
